DAY TWO: EURO CUP
Day two of the euro cup concludes and group B have played their first matches. Germany triumphed over Poland with a 2-0 win and Croatia receive their three points for their first game's 1-0 win over Austria.
GERMANY VS POLAND 2-0
Despite their success Germany are not the group B favourites to go through to the next stage.
Co-host Austria have taken that role but the German side proved that they have the most chances of going through when winning an amazing 2-0 game against Poland.
Both goals coming from the Polish born Lucas Podolski, the German forward finished off being the night's hero.
Poland struggled to pass through the German defense and no doubt they aim to win their next match against Austria.
CROATIA VS AUSTRIA 1-0
Croatia have crushed the hopes of the co-hosts Austria with their 1-0 win.
An early penalty from Luka Modric put the Croatian side at front.
Austria couldn't recover in the first half of the game but began to lift their form in the second, where they dominted most of the play.
They are now hoping to restore their position as respesentatives of Austria in their next match against Poland.
Austria's coach Josef Hickersberger is more hopeful of their next match since they have already played their first game. They need four points to qualify for the next round.
